Need to know about Skillet Creek Campground
Welcome to the park!
To ensure the comfort and safety of our guests, please abide by the following rules:
Check in Procedure - Check-in time 12 PM until office closes, RV/Tent sites 2 PM until office closes lodging rentals. - Check-out time by 12 PM RV/Tent sites, by 11 AM lodging rentals - While each park attempts to accommodate your exact spot request, the on-site manager has the ultimate decision for spot placement. Office & Facility Hours Office/store closes at 10 PM: Friday nights. - 8 PM Sun–Thur night. - 9 PM Saturday nights (Shoulder Season). - 10 PM Saturday nights (Memorial – Labor Day). Barn Game Room/Laundromat - 8 AM–10 PM, Fri & Sat. - 8 AM–8 PM, Sun–Thu. Speed Limit & Safety - Speed limit is 5 mph or less. - Our little ones thank you for driving slowly. Safety - No weapons or fireworks allowed in the park. Children - Your children are your responsibility. - All minors must be accompanied by an adult. - All kids must be back to your site at 10pm. Fire Policy - Fires in fire rings only. - Please do not move fire rings. Water & Dumping - Fresh water hose every RV/travel trailer is required to have a fresh water RV Hose. Dump Station - No dumping of gray water. - Use a holding tank or the dump station. Pet Policy - Two animals per campsite. - Pets must be leashed, picked up after and never left unattended. - If your dog is aggressive towards people or other animals, please do not bring them to the campground. Vehicles & Parking - You are allowed two vehicles per site. - No parking on roads. - Every vehicle must display a car pass. Visitors - All visitors must register in the office and get a car pass. - Day passes are valid until 10 pm. - Visitors are subject to all campground rules. Facility Services - Bathrooms and showers available. - Food and drink service hours will be posted throughout the campground. Barn Game Room/Laundromat - The upper part of the barn holds coin operated washer/dryers for your use and a game room. Firewood - Available at the Office/Store. - We do not allow firewood to be brought in. - Cutting trees is prohibited. Fishing - Fishing is available for catch & release, no license required. Hiking Trail - Please keep the trail clean. No Smoking - No smoking in the barn (Game Room/Laundromat), Restrooms or Office/store. Playgrounds - Children must be supervised at all times. - Playground closes at dark. - We are not responsible for injuries or accidents. Showers - Showers are free (5-minute limit). - Please respect others. - Please do not do dishes in bathrooms. Swimming Pond - Must adhere to swimming pond rules posted at pond. Garbage & Cleanliness - Reduce, reuse, recycle. - Bins are available as you exit the park, please put all aluminum cans in the appropriate bin. - Do not leave bags of trash at the site or trash in your firepit. - We do not pick up bags of trash. - Your firepit is not a garbage can. How to read Good Sam Ratings
The three-number rating that accompanies each campground listing in the directory gives readers an at-a-glance assessment of a campground's amenities, cleanliness and environment. All three ratings categories are measured on a scale of 1 to 10, with 10 being the best. Less than 1 percent of parks or campgrounds receive the coveted 10 | 10 | 10 rating, which indicates superior facilities that are well maintained, clean, well-appointed restrooms and a highly appealing appearance. Campgrounds are inspected annually by dedicated RVers like you.
Completeness of facilities
The first campground rating evaluates completeness and quality of facilities. In this category we rate interior roads, sites, registration area, hookups, recreation, swimming, security, laundry, store and building maintenance.
Cleanliness of restrooms and showers
The second rating category concerns the cleanliness and physical characteristics of toilets, walls, showers, sinks/counters/mirrors and floor. If a park achieves a full point in each of the above, it receives a star ( ), indicating exceptionally clean restrooms.
Also rated are physical characteristics of restrooms, including interior construction, adequate supplies/odor free, adequate number of facilities, exterior appearance and location in relation to park spaces, and interior appearance.
Visual appeal and environmental quality
This category addresses the park's setting and site layout, function and identification of signage, overall exterior building maintenance, noise, trash disposal, litter and debris around the grounds and sites, and appearance of grounds, sites and entrance area.
